PSL question

I found a guy selling a PSL locally. He wants $1100 for the rifle, but doesn't have the factory lps 4x6 scope. I wanted to buy this as a collectors item, so originality is important to me. I can't find any for sale online.

Should I buy the rifle alone and hope to find a scope later? Also, for those who own this optic, are they easy to use and effective? Is the factory scope worth it?

General psl reviews are also good. I have an SVT 40 and 54r VEPR

There used to be a ton of scopes for sale online at stupid low prices. I have 5 of them, 4 in use. I got them all for just over $100 each, but those prices have basically tripled. PSL scopes are fairly easy to find with a little patience on ebay. Search lps scope or tip-2 scope, and you'll get results soon. You just won't like the price. I like them better than the 6x24 or 8x42 posps I've used.

>Is there anything in particular that I should look out for?
For now.
Just try different ammo types before you settle on one, some shoot FAR better than others.
Russian LVE headstamped noncorrosive ammo and factory 188 are great shooters from mine. Romanian is crap. Bulgarian is "ok" but has oddball flyers sometimes.
And there's good 150gr hunting ammo if you really need to find some. Pic related.

>Do you have rust problems when using surplus ammo?
Not really, it's pretty easy to get the tube looking brand new with a 12ga brush, then finish with a snake. Then I just wipe the bolt face and piston for the most part.
I don't actually clean the gas block much, just spray oil in there to leave a coating in the port and wipe the block the best I can with a cloth and finger. Then I snake the barrel to catch the excess oil dripping from that.
A little oil coat afterwards seems to keep anything from rusting since it keeps moisture away. I basically just keep a layer of remoil on internal surfaces and never clean much else.
